Low Harmonic Distortion
High harmonic handling quality is another feature. In general, solar inverters generate harmonics on the power side. But a solar transformer can handle it because it is engineered with improved core material and higher K-factor ratings. So, they are designed to handle these harmonics without overheating.
Electrostatic Shielding Between Windings
As a leading manufacturer, Lakshmi uses a copper shield in solar transformers to reduce voltage surges and suppress electromagnetic interference from inverter switching pulses. This feature enables the equipment to protect the grid and connected equipment.

Dual Voltage Operation
Solar transformers are designed to step up the inverter output (generally 400–800V) to the grid voltage (11kV/33kV or higher). Plus, it has multi-winding designs that ensure 100% compatibility with a wide range of inverter types.
Low Loss Design
The use of CRGO or Amorphous metal core allows the transformer to reduce no-load and load losses. This quality ensures better energy conversion efficiency. It is very important for solar power economics.
